Transaction 6e85bb1076382e2c2514d31e7b7e16566f70f3c7e656364d3cf21defd4dbf11b
1 Input
1 Output
-
6e85bb1076382e2c2514d31e7b7e16566f70f3c7e656364d3cf21defd4dbf11b:0
- value
- 1381720
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 23d7173923cdaafa1e052f33e9155039f5470860 OP_EQUAL
- address
- 34xXF2GkXsd8C5JvncVSxY24ygkfHpBaYt